Light Stick

Earthquake chic is shaking the world! - or so claims Gus Design Group, maker of the 6 foot long Light Stick. Motivated by the desire to create home furnishings that look good at any angle - whether neatly arranged or strewn haphhazardly against a wall - Gus Design has come up with a line of “Earthquake Chic” products: furniture that looks great in your house under normal circumstances, but still looks just as great after an earthquake.

“It?s six feet of lamp, but disguised as a tilted steel beam. You could almost believe it fell during a tremor, although not likely at such a rakish angle.”
